I would like a discussion about Allison C3 approved oil for use in a Volvo loader transmission, particularly about 15w40 engine oils vs like an ATF. If I understand correctly, the TES 439 is the newest standard which covers the C3 approval. What are the pros/cons of using engine oil vs an ATF, (other than only needing 1 oil on the shelf). This is a high hour transmission if that makes any difference.

I was thinking of just going with Rottella t4 or Mobil Delvac, unless somebody gives me a good reason not to.

If this loader is operated in a cold climate, you'll be much happier with ATF, because it will flow much better.

That was one consideration I did have, but it does get used in the heat of the summer, so I wasn't sure how much consideration I would give to the season.
 
I have run machinery hydraulics with standard viscosity hydraulic fluid that were dog slow in the winter. Replace the standard viscosity with low viscosity and the hydraulics respond much better.
